[[Death-T]] is an arc in the manga, where Yugi is forced to play in Kaiba's theme park of death.
  
 
Kaiba invites Yugi to his mansion the night before the opening of his [[KaibaLand]] theme park. At the grand opening, he reveals he has kidnapped Yugi's grandfather and Duels him. They Duel using [[Battle Box]]es rather than the large [[Dueling Arena]]s. Sugoroku uses "Blue-Eyes White Dragon", but is overwhelmed by the holograms and Kaiba's 3 "Blue-Eyes White Dragons". Kaiba tears up Sugoroku's "Blue-Eyes White Dragon" and subjects him to an artificial [[Penalty Game]]. In order for him to be released, Yugi is coerced into swearing he will face Kaiba's Death-T. Like in the anime, Sugoroku gives Yugi his Deck to use against Kaiba.
